2 stars A somewhat dispensable accompaniment to a wholly dispensable film, "Codename Wildgeese" sounds even less like a shoot up em soundtrack than it does like an ELOY album. In fact, while it virtually lacks a rock aspect other than one dreadful vocal number ("Queen of Rock and Roll") and a serviceable instrumental ("Juke-Box"), the synth sounds are not entirely removed from those being made on the contemporaneous ELOY issues of the day, neither of which I would ever consider as peak period for this monster German symphonic group. What it lacks is any attempt at actual composition, which perhaps might have to do with Frank Bornemann's absenteeism.

Codename Wildgeese is mostly an amalgamation of short synth pieces that at their worst approach supermarket new age music and at their best, such as in "On the Edge", recall GOBLIN. "Patrol" , "Discovery" and the Hong Kong themes are competent if routine instrumentals that could easily be fillers on ELOY or PETE BARDENS albums, which isn't the worst idea, while "A Long Goodbye" is somewhat more engaging with faux synths that are reminiscent of....I'm drawing a blank. For the rest, ick. Still much better than the film I'd wager.

I can't really award this 3 stars but it's not far off 2.5 to be honest, and much better than I expected. But what eventually tips the scales is that it's really for fans like me who have every other ELOY studio album and are fed up with wondering how bad this could be. Codename mediocre.
